Transaction 6074457c50442b675650761f13c7962ec91e513acbf292d799fc11462ce7e48e

1 Input
2 Outputs
  • 6074457c50442b675650761f13c7962ec91e513acbf292d799fc11462ce7e48e:0
  • value  10080000
    address  16Xg8UVKVPCStG6qr9oSNsPtRfSnyCWYmT
  • 6074457c50442b675650761f13c7962ec91e513acbf292d799fc11462ce7e48e:1
  • value  2500564
    address  1DFqVwpPXNRQ3CsZ6TNEBxtbhEqHzpqPFR